Customer.io: REST APIs split by purpose: Track API for data ingestion, App API for campaigns, people lookups, and messages. Authentication: Basic auth with site ID and API key for the Track API; bearer token for the App API. Rillet: REST API (OpenAPI-specified, with production and sandbox environments). Authentication: API key generated in Rillet (Organization Setting -> API Access); uncheck Read Only for bidirectional sync, check Read Only for one-way sync. Stacksync manages authentication, retries, and rate limits on both sides.
